Hey all,

My game group is getting a small league together, 6 guys, roughly 5-10 games for the league, plus up to 5 preseason games.

I'm having a hard time deciding which team to field - I've narrowed it down to a few, and would like to hear your thoughts on them:

1. Amazons: Like their starting roster - 4 blodging blitzers - low reroll cost - you can make a healthy roster from the git-go.
PROS - Dodge for everyone! 4 blitzers? Yes please!
CONS - AV7 AND ST3 AND AG3 - Ouch. No Big guys. Can they win vs. teams with tackle?

2. Pro elf: Like the idea of AG4 - it would be nice to pick up the ball in the open on a 2+. Not to mention a strong ball-handling game.
PROS - AG4 for a reasonable price. A fast runner with both AG4 AND ST3.
CONS - AV7 means these guys will take a beating - poor linemen! No big guy option.

3. Ogre: Talk about scary! In my test game with these guys they pounded the heck out of the other team - when they didnt go stupid.
PROS - Duh, they're ogres! STR5, high armor, nasty skills.
CONS - Snot star players? They'll be scoring your Touchdowns - and they cant survive even the weakest of blocks. Ogres can technically run the ball, but can go stupid - simply unreliable.

So what do you think? What other teams should I consider? Any help would be appreciated! Thanks!

So we're talking about a maximum of 15 games here, right ?

For me, it's Amazons for sure. Cheap, loads of skills, perfect for a rather short league. They start to decline when those other teams got skill combo of Tackle and Mightly Blow on one or several players, but your league should be over before this happens a lot. The only reason I wouldn't play them is having more than 1 Dwarf/Chaos Dwarf team in your league. To be honest, you'll be bashed into the ground by those teams most of the time.

Elfs do need some time to develop. They have great Blitzers and Catchers, but especially those Catchers need 16 SPP's to be really effective. I personally like them very much for league play, but I would only play them if you were to hit those 15 games.

Don't let your Orge experience fool you, my very jung Padawan. It's true, sometimes they'll win a game by smashing the opponent into the ground. I once played with my Norse against them, and non of my players was left on the field in the mid of the second half. BUT that's not the normal way. We've started a fresh league recently, one of the coaches is playing Ogres. I've played with my experimental fresh Wood Elf team (zero Rerolls, lots of positonals) against them and won 5:0 (5:2). That's how most matches will end, with a loss. Sure, you'll make some casualies because of Mighty Blow, but your opponent will hunt down those mini Goblins (forgot their name right now) and make even more SSP's.
